Title

Qualitative Screening of Phytochemicals which present in Curcuma Longa

Abstract

According to World Health Organization (WHO), medicinal plants contain the best source of bio-active compounds which is used to obtain a variety of drugs and more than 80% of the world population depends on traditional medicine which naturally forms for their primary health care needs. Bio-active compounds are found most naturally in the medicinal plants are known as phytochemicals. Medicinal plants like turmeric which has scientific name Curcuma Longa. The bright yellow colour of turmeric comes from polyphenolic pigments which present inside that are mainly comes from fat-soluble known as Curcuminoids. Turmeric contains many phytochemical compounds like tannin, proteins, flavonoids, alkaloids, carbohydrates, etc. These phytochemicals have disease preventive properties because they are non-nutritive chemical plant. In this study, three different types of turmeric samples (i.e., two different dried turmeric powders and one is raw turmeric which later converted into dried powder using an oven at 450C) were selected from three different places for screening using the proposed brewing method such as hard, soft and ambient infusion to characterize their anti-oxidant potential. Among them, hard infusion shows the highest anti-oxidant potential as compared to the soft and ambient infusion in all three different turmeric samples. The present study of qualitative phytochemicals screening of turmeric (Curcuma Longa), to determine the present phytochemicals and were proved their capability to acts as the source of useful medicinal drugs and also it has potential to improve human health naturally as a result of the presence of various bioactive compounds that are important for good health.
